Legislation and Regulations
Everything you need to know about import rules
La RD Congo a sa propre réglementation douanière gérée par la DGDA. Le port de Matadi est le principal point d'entrée, suivi d'un transport terrestre vers Kinshasa.
Pas de limite d'âge stricte pour les véhicules, mais les taxes augmentent avec l'ancienneté. Certificat de non-gage requis.
The DGDA handles imports. Clearance at Matadi can take 7-14 days. Transport Matadi→Kinshasa adds 1-2 days. For Lubumbashi the transit is even longer.
